Thanksgiving morning brought a new tradition to Newnan this year as more than 400 runners lined up at Summergrove Town Hall for the Coweta Comets’ inaugural LINC’d Up Turkey Trot.
What organizers hoped would be a modest first effort quickly became one of the largest holiday running events the community has seen in years. According to race results, 409 runners finished the 5K and more than 60 children participated in the 1-mile fun run, far surpassing expectations for a debut event.

“We thought early on that 300 would help us break even,” said Comets representative Brent Snodgrass. “But with sponsorships and the huge turnout, we’re able to donate a lot to the schools.”
